Primary Gumball Machines! First Grade!

In First grade, we had so much fun making mixed media gumball machines! We used our prior knowledge of lines and shapes to create the different pieces of the machine. Then, we glued all of the parts down to our background paper, and last, but not least, we got to use our fingers as a paintbrush to paint the gumballs!!!! The students mixed the primary colors together if they wanted orange, green, and purple gumballs for their machine! These turned out absolutely fabulous!

Picasso Hearts - 1st Grade!

Since Valentine's is right around the corner, what a great time to learn about Picasso and symmetry! This is our second Picasso Project this year in 1st grade! The students first painted a lovely design on pink or red paper and then learned how to cut a giant heart out of their paper while it was folded in half! Then they got to add even more decorations to make it really special! Check out the great hearts below:

Positive/Negative Snowflakes - 4th Grade!

In 4th grade, we learned about lines of symmetry and creating a negative part of a shape by cutting part of it out (the positive!). The line we created by gluing them side-by-side is the line of symmetry! How cool is that?!






The cutting was mighty tricky, but we got it!
